How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 78223?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 78223 Studio Apartments | $846 | $645 | $1,734 |
| 78223 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,153 | $485 | $2,920 |
| 78223 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,307 | $585 | $2,900 |
| 78223 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,941 | $753 | $4,401 |
| 78223 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,166 | $1,350 | $2,855 |
